Linux에서의 C 프로그래밍에 대한 자세한 설명... 1 1) 리눅스 프로그래밍 입문 - 기초지식...3 1. 소스 프로그램 컴파일... 3 2.메이크파일 작성...4 3. 프로그램 라이브러리 링크... 5 4. 프로그램 디버깅... 5 5.헤더 파일 및 시스템 도움말... 6
2) Linux 프로그래밍 입문 - 프로세스 소개... 6 1. 프로세스의 개념...6 2. 프로세스 플래그... 7 3. 프로세스 생성...8 4. 데몬 프로세스 생성...9
3) 리눅스 프로그래밍 입문 - 파일 조작... 10 1. 파일 생성, 읽기 및 쓰기... 10 2. 파일의 다양한 속성... 11 3. 디렉터리 파일 작업... 12 4. 파이프 파일... 13
4) 프로그래밍 입문 - 시간의 개념... 14 1. 시간 표현... 14 2. 시간의 측정... 14 3. 타이머의 사용... 15
5) 리눅스 프로그래밍 입문 - 신호 처리... 16 1. 신호 생성...16 2. 신호 작동... 17 3. 기타 신호 기능... 18 4. 예... 18
6) Linux 프로그래밍 입문 - 메시지 관리... 19 1. POSIX 이름 없는 세마포어... 19 2. 시스템 V 세마포어... 20 3. SystemV 메시지 큐... 21 4. SystemV 공유 메모리... 22
7) Linux 프로그래밍 입문 - 스레드 작업... 23 스레드 생성 및 사용... 23 8) 리눅스 프로그래밍 입문--네트워크 프로그래밍...25 9) Linux에서의 C 개발 도구 소개...47
GNU C 컴파일러...47 GCC 사용..48 GCC 옵션...48 최적화 옵션...49 디버깅 및 프로파일링 옵션... 49 gdb 기본 명령... 50 추가 C 프로그래밍 도구...52 xxgdb.52 53 전화. 콜트리.54 들여쓰기 55 gprof 56